Output 67867fe30e65cd9d65339455c1ec44f06c7e7ba17f634ab891790e03b470f460:1

value
25378101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d10e954d6baa32003ccd6b32dda3c6abb819c4 OP_EQUAL
address
MPZeDmNTFtig7fAzUAvSQ7W7Ny5QqFgA75
transaction
67867fe30e65cd9d65339455c1ec44f06c7e7ba17f634ab891790e03b470f460
spent
true